在信息化时代,数据库已经成为企业、机构和个人存储和管理数据的重要工具。然而,数据库崩溃或数据丢失的情况时有发生,这无疑会给我们的工作和生活带来极大的困扰。别慌,以下是一些数据恢复技巧,帮助你找回丢失的信息。
数据备份的重要性
在探讨数据恢复之前,我们必须强调数据备份的重要性。就像保险一样,数据备份可以在数据库崩溃时为你提供保障。以下是一些有效的数据备份方法:
- 定期全量备份:将整个数据库的数据复制到备份存储介质上,如硬盘、光盘等。
- 增量备份:只备份自上次全量备份或增量备份以来发生变化的数据。
- 差异备份:备份自上次全量备份以来发生变化的数据,而不是每次都备份整个数据库。
数据恢复技巧
1. 使用数据库自带的数据恢复工具
大多数数据库管理系统(DBMS)都提供了数据恢复工具。以下是一些常见数据库的数据恢复方法:
- MySQL:使用
mysqlcheck工具进行数据恢复,或者使用mysql命令行工具进行数据导入。 - Oracle:使用
expdp和impdp工具进行数据导出和导入。 - SQL Server:使用
RESTORE DATABASE命令进行数据恢复。
2. 使用第三方数据恢复工具
如果数据库自带的数据恢复工具无法解决问题,你可以尝试使用第三方数据恢复工具。以下是一些常用的第三方数据恢复工具:
- EaseUS Data Recovery Wizard:支持多种数据库的恢复,操作简单易用。
- Recuva:适用于恢复各种文件类型,包括数据库文件。
- DBCC CHECKDB:SQL Server自带的数据库检查和修复工具。
3. 手动恢复数据
在某些情况下,你可能需要手动恢复数据。以下是一些手动恢复数据的步骤:
- 检查数据库文件:确认数据库文件是否存在,以及文件是否损坏。
- 恢复备份:如果之前进行了数据备份,尝试从备份中恢复数据。
- 修复数据库:使用数据库自带或第三方工具修复损坏的数据库文件。
- 重建索引:重建数据库索引,提高数据库性能。
4. 寻求专业帮助
如果以上方法都无法解决问题,建议寻求专业数据恢复公司的帮助。他们拥有丰富的经验和专业的工具,可以帮你恢复丢失的数据。
总结
数据库崩溃或数据丢失是一件令人头疼的事情,但只要我们掌握了正确的数据恢复技巧,就能最大限度地减少损失。记住,数据备份是预防数据丢失的最佳方法。希望以上内容能帮助你找回丢失的信息。
